Core Components of Comprehensive Training

  • Foundations of Machine Learning: This includes understanding data types, statistical concepts, and basic programming in languages like Python.

  • Supervised Learning: Explore algorithms such as linear regression, logistic regression, decision trees, random forests, and support vector machines. These are crucial for predictive modeling.

  • Unsupervised Learning: Learn about clustering techniques like K-Means and hierarchical clustering, along with dimensionality reduction methods such as PCA.

  • Deep Learning: Dive into neural networks, convolutional neural networks (CNNs), and recurrent neural networks (RNNs) for complex pattern recognition and natural language processing.

  • Reinforcement Learning: Understand how agents learn to make decisions in an environment to maximize rewards.

  • Model Evaluation and Deployment: Master techniques for assessing model performance, preventing overfitting, and deploying models into production environments.

  • Ethical AI: Gain insights into the ethical implications of AI and machine learning, ensuring responsible development and deployment.

Factors to Consider When Selecting Training

  • Curriculum Depth and Breadth: Ensure the program covers essential topics and allows for specialization in areas of interest.

  • Instructor Expertise: Look for instructors with significant industry experience and a strong track record in machine learning.

  • Hands-on Projects and Labs: Practical exercises are crucial for applying learned concepts and developing problem-solving skills.

  • Flexibility and Format: Consider whether an online, in-person, self-paced, or cohort-based program best suits your schedule and learning preferences.

  • Certification and Accreditation: A reputable certification can validate your skills and enhance your professional credibility.

  • Community and Support: Access to a learning community and instructor support can significantly enrich the training experience.
